1. What is the Best Overall Air Gauge?
The Accutire MS-4021 Digital air gauge is the best overall due to its accuracy, ergonomic design, and ease of use. Its consistent and precise readings make it a top choice for maintaining optimal tire pressure. According to a study by the National Highway Traffic Safety Administration (NHTSA), proper tire inflation can improve fuel efficiency by up to 3.3%.
2. What Makes the Accutire MS-4021 Digital Air Gauge Stand Out?
The Accutire MS-4021 Digital stands out because of its ergonomic shape, which aligns the user’s thumb with the tire valve for accurate readings. The rubber-coated handle ensures comfort for various hand sizes. The display freezes, allowing users to easily read the pressure. It operates between 14 to 122 degrees Fahrenheit and is accurate to 0.5 PSI.

3. What Are the Key Specifications of the Accutire MS-4021 Digital Air Gauge?
Key specifications include:
Specification | Detail |
---|---|
Increments | 0.5 psi |
PSI Range | 5 to 150 |
Accuracy | +/- (1%+1LSD) – recalibration directions |
Unit Settings | PSI, BAR, kPa, Kg/cm |
Operating Temperature | 14 to 122F |

5. How Does the JACO ElitePro 100 PSI Air Gauge Compare?
The JACO ElitePro 100 PSI is a battery-free option that provides accurate readings and is certified to ANSI standards. Its sturdy build and 360-degree swivel chuck make it user-friendly. The glow-in-the-dark dial allows for easy night-time readings, making it a reliable tire pressure monitoring system.
6. What Are the Advantages of a Dial-Style Air Gauge Like the JACO ElitePro 100 PSI?
Dial-style gauges have a bleeder valve to release air precisely. They are less affected by cold weather compared to digital gauges. The JACO ElitePro 100 PSI can glow in the dark, making it ideal for nighttime use. These features make it a practical choice for various conditions.

9. What Is the Best Budget-Friendly Air Gauge?
The Milton S-921 Pencil Gauge is the best budget-friendly option. Its durable, battery-free design ensures reliability in all temperatures. The built-in deflator adds convenience, making it an essential tool for basic tire maintenance.
10. What Makes the Milton S-921 Pencil Gauge a Classic?
The Milton S-921 Pencil Gauge is a classic due to its simplicity and durability. With only one moving part and no batteries, it works under almost any conditions. Its compact size allows it to fit in any glove box, making it a reliable backup tool.

13. What is the Best Air Gauge for Heavy-Duty Applications?
The AstroAI Digital Dual Head 230 PSI air gauge is ideal for heavy-duty applications, especially tires with inward-facing valves or those requiring higher pressures. Its durable stainless-steel chuck and bright, backlit LCD screen make it easy to use in various conditions.
14. What Makes the AstroAI Digital Dual Head 230 PSI Suitable for Larger Tires?
The AstroAI Digital Dual Head 230 PSI is designed with a dual head, making it suitable for truck tires with inward valves. The gauge forms a good seal, and the built-in flashlight helps locate the tire valve in low light conditions.

17. How Do the Different Air Gauges Compare in Terms of Accuracy?
The Accutire MS-4021 Digital and JACO ElitePro 100 PSI are the most accurate, with the Accutire consistently matching the air pressure. The Milton S-921 Pencil Gauge tends to read about 1 PSI higher, making it less precise.
18. What Are the Durability Considerations for Each Air Gauge?
The Milton S-921 Pencil Gauge is the most durable due to its simple design and lack of batteries. Dial gauges like the JACO ElitePro 100 PSI are more vulnerable due to their moving parts but are often protected with rubber guards.
19. Which Air Gauge Is Easiest to Use for Checking Tire Pressure?
The Accutire MS-4021 Digital and Milton S-921 Pencil Gauge are the easiest to use due to their straightforward designs and consistent seal. The JACO ElitePro 100 PSI also provides a good seal but requires two hands for operation.

33. How do Temperature Changes Affect Tire Pressure?
For every 10-degree Fahrenheit change in temperature, tire pressure changes by about 1 PSI. Lower temperatures decrease tire pressure, while higher temperatures increase it. Adjusting tire pressure based on temperature is essential for maintaining optimal performance.

40. How Does an Air Gauge Contribute to Tire Longevity?
Maintaining proper tire pressure with an air gauge ensures even wear across the tire surface, extending its lifespan. Underinflated tires wear more on the edges, while overinflated tires wear more in the center.
41. What Should I Do if My Air Gauge Gives Inconsistent Readings?
If your air gauge gives inconsistent readings, check the tire valve for debris or damage. Also, ensure the gauge is properly sealed against the valve stem. If the issue persists, it may be time to replace the gauge.
